Transaction 39708459b68c07419c7828dab0054ec20e77ee5c8d2fc124db8bb5fb9a5b9bee
1 Input
1 Output
-
39708459b68c07419c7828dab0054ec20e77ee5c8d2fc124db8bb5fb9a5b9bee:0
- value
- 428703
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90159192d1f56ab4aa0e03955ace4d6730c59abc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E8r9EtPkc4RS4AiuKBip3AdfdtGoYZqrY